Project file Accidently Purged

We started a project with many families loaded in, and the project was purged so we lost all families that weren't being used yet.  Is there any way to load whole sets of families from another project, or from a template?

Once the family is purged you will have to reload them. 

 

Go to INSERT 

click on LOAD FROM

then click LOAD FAMILY

 

that should work for you.

Takes hours to do when you have 150 custom families.  I found a faster way, Opening folders through windows explorer containing the families, dragging and dropping into the project.  I didn't know what was purged out and what was not, was hoping i could get the whole set from the template we set up with all familes we use.
